Output 81e16ddcc60976ec446ad3efbecad90745aef34ce0709edb4286df956d3c28d6:1

value
4408321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b31d1ef623892318204a7c07b01473a54ac7bca OP_EQUAL
address
3P8cQBXTR8inRDxQSUbLc8Mrp1VUGLZ3yh
transaction
81e16ddcc60976ec446ad3efbecad90745aef34ce0709edb4286df956d3c28d6
confirmations
214068
spent
true